Windows & GlassLaminated Glass: The Clear Choice for Safety, Comfort, and Efficiency
Laminated glass is a superior choice for those seeking safety, efficiency, and aesthetic appeal in their building materials. This versatile material not only stays intact when broken, providing enhanced security, but also offers UV protection, noise reduction, and energy efficiency. Discover how laminated glass can enhance your home or office by making it safer and more comfortable.

Garage DoorsEnhancing Your Home’s Energy Efficiency with the Right Garage Door
Investing in an energy-efficient garage door significantly enhances your home's thermal envelope, leading to lower energy bills and a more comfortable living environment. Modern garage doors with high R-values and low U-factors offer superior insulation, making them a crucial component in your home’s energy conservation efforts.
